User Agent: Mozilla/5.0 (Windows NT 6.1; WOW64; rv:35.0) Gecko/20100101 Firefox/35.0
Build ID: 20150108202552
Steps to reproduce:
1) Check "Provide search suggestions" in search settings options.
2) Check "When I open a link in a new tab, switch to it immediately" in tabs options.
3) Key in a search argument, Middle Click mouse on one of the suggestions.
Actual results:
A new tab is opened with results of search, but FF does NOT "switch to it immediately".
Expected results:
FF should have switched to the new tab immediately.
This is the way it worked prior to FF ver 35.0.
All other "switch to new tab" functions seem to work well.
